Building Energy Simulation Software Market Share is Anticipated to Register a CAGR of over 10.7% during 2023 - 2031 - Market Size, Share, Forecasts, and Trends Analysis Report by Transparency Market Research

Tuesday, 30 May 2023 01:40 PM

WILMINGTON, DE / ACCESSWIRE / May 30, 2023 / Transparency Market Research Inc. - The global building energy simulation software market stood at US$ 4.4 billion in 2022 and the global market is projected to reach US$ 10.8 billion in 2031. Global building energy simulation software industry is anticipated to expand at a CAGR of 10.7% between 2023 and 2031.

Global Building Energy simulation software market: Growth Drivers

  • Growth of the building energy software industries is being impelled by the expansion in the utilization of smart grids and smart meters. Smart grids are advanced digital technologies that empower two-way communication for electricity distribution, while such smart building energy meters are electronic devices that will instantly record and broadcast energy consumption data to utility providers. Technologies are now becoming increasingly popular in recent times due to their efficacy in reducing electricity costs for consumers.
  • Commercialising AI and ML technologies is likely to automatize the stimulation process by making better predictions and also by the provision of real-time insights for energy optimization. Integration is thus said to reinforce the speed, accuracy, and intelligence of the software, by enablement of more advanced and sufficient energy analysis.

Global Building Energy Simulation Software Market: Regional Landscape

  • Global building energy simulation software market in the U.S. is estimated at US$ 297.3 million as the growth of the market is attributed to the presence of renowned institutions, universities, and laboratories.
  • Asia Pacific is said to hold the second position in this market region where China, the world`s second-most lucrative economy, is forecasted to reach a projected market size of US$ 225.7 million following a CAGR of 6.8% over the forecast period. Japan and Canada, are each forecasted to grow at 5.9% and 5.6% respectively during the forecasted period.
